Conversion Formula for Gallon Us Per Day to Deciliter Per Second
Conversion from gallon us per day to deciliter per second is a simple process once you know the basic relationship between the two units. One Gallon Us Per Day is equal to 0.000438126 Deciliter Per Second, while one Deciliter Per Second contains 2,282.4484280778 Gallon Us Per Day.
To change a measurement from gallon us per day to deciliter per second, you only need to multiply the number of gallon us per day by 0.000438126.
1 Gallon Us Per Day = 0.000438126 Deciliter Per Second
1 Deciliter Per Second = 2,282.4484280778 Gallon Us Per Day
This gives you the equivalent value in deciliter per second quickly and accurately. By using this straightforward formula, you can easily switch between these units whenever needed.

US Gallon per Day Flow Rate
Introduction : This unit indicates flow over a 24-hour period, suitable for gradual processes like home water filters, drip irrigation, or nutrient delivery systems.
History & Origin : With increasing interest in daily water consumption and conservation during the 20th century, gallon/day became a relevant measure in environmental studies and domestic planning.
Current Use : Common in residential water use tracking, filtration systems, and long-duration irrigation schedules to monitor and limit water consumption.
Deciliter per Second
Introduction : A metric-based unit denoting 0.1 liters per second, striking a balance between liters and milliliters.
History & Origin : Grew out of decimal liter divisions used in medical and food science contexts.
Current Use : Common in beverage manufacturing, pharmacology, and flow calibration tools.
